Fresh herbs for a kitchen

Article Abstract:

The herb garden used for the 'Southern Living' test kitchens is began as a circular bed with a few herbs, and has grown into a large kitchen garden that includes some vegetables and berries. A successful herb garden should receive 8 hours of full sun and have well-drained soil.

Creative staking

Article Abstract:

Bamboos, wisteria, elaegnus and other vines can be used to support the long shoots of paperwhites. Aside from the beauty of using natural materials as stacks, they are easy to bend and twist around pots, as well.
